Recommended Cutting Parameters
| Material Group | Vc (m/min) | fn (mm/rev) |
|---|---|---|
| Carbon Steel (ISO P) | 90 - 180 | 0.10 - 0.25 |
| Stainless Steel (ISO M) | 70 - 140 | 0.08 - 0.20 |

We offer optimized CVD and PVD multi-layer coatings for different ISO material groups:
- For Carbon/Alloy Steel (ISO P): Choose our thick multi-layer CVD coated grades (e.g., Al2O3 + TiN). They provide exceptional crater wear resistance and thermal barriers during high-speed dry or wet roughing.
- For Stainless Steel (ISO M): Choose our nano-structured PVD coated grades with sharp, positive chipbreakers (like -TM or -MA). This combination prevents work hardening and effectively controls sticky chips.
The optimal cutting parameters vary depending on the workpiece hardness and operation type:
- For General Steel Turnings: Recommended cutting speed ($V_c$) ranges from 150 to 280 m/min, with a feed rate ($f$) of 0.15 to 0.45 mm/rev.
- For Stainless Steel Finishing: Recommended cutting speed ($V_c$) is 120 to 200 m/min, with a feed rate ($f$) of 0.10 to 0.25 mm/rev.Always adjust parameters based on early wear patterns: increase $V_c$ if built-up edge occurs, or reduce $V_c$ if severe flank wear is observed.
